SUSE CVE-2026-53025

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: greybus: raw: fix use-after-free on cdev close This addresses a use-after-free bug when a raw bundle is disconnected but its chardev is still opened by an application. CVE-2026-23331 udp: Unhash auto-bound connected sk from 4-tuple hash table when disconnected.

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: udp: Unhash auto-bound connected sk from 4-tuple hash table when disconnected.
